#70664e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#70664e is composed of 43.9% red, 40%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8.9% magenta, 30.4%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 42.4 degrees, a saturation of 17.9% and a lightness of 37.3%. #70664e color hex could be obtained by blending #e0cc9c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

#70664e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#70664e has RGB values of R:112, G:102,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.09, Y:0.3,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7366222.
